Lawrence High School Choral Ensemble Honors Veterans with Musical Tribute
Lawrence High School’s Choral Ensemble performed at the Village of Cedarhurts’s Veterans Day Memorial Ceremony earlier this month, paying tribute to the nation’s heroes through the power of song.
The talented group of young singers, under the direction of their dedicated music teachers, delivered a moving performance of the National Anthem and God Bless America at the annual event. Their harmonious renditions resonated with the attendees, adding a poignant touch to the ceremony.
“We are incredibly proud of our Choral Ensemble for their heartfelt performance at the Veterans Day Memorial Ceremony, “ said Dr. Jennifer Lagnado-Papp, Principal of Lawrence High School. “Their dedication to their craft and their respect for our veterans shone through in every note. It was a truly fitting tribute to the brave men and women who have served our country.”
